
Siemens Building Technology 242-00212 Valve Assembly
The Siemens 242-00212 is a heavy-duty 2-way normally closed zone valve engineered for precision control in hydronic heating and cooling systems. Built with a 3/4" NPT brass body and robust brass trim, this assembly handles a 4.1 Cv linear flow rate, making it ideal for baseboard radiation, convectors, and fan coil units. The integrated 24Vac spring return actuator ensuring a failsafe close upon power loss, preventing unauthorized flow and protecting system integrity. Designed for high-repetition cycling, the two-position actuated zone valve provides a tight shut-off and reliable operation in demanding commercial or residential mechanical rooms. This Siemens replacement valve is a standard in the industry for technicians requiring a drop-in solution that interfaces seamlessly with existing low-voltage thermostats and zone controllers. Its spring return mechanism is geared for longevity, minimizing water hammer and ensuring quiet, consistent performance in closed-loop systems.
Key Benefits
- Consistent Flow Control: The 4.1 Cv rating and linear flow characteristic provide predictable temperature management across the loop.
- Rugged Construction: Forged brass body prevents premature corrosion and scales, ensuring long-term seat integrity.
- Failsafe Operation: The powerful internal spring return automatically seals the valve during power interruptions.
- Easy Integration: Standard 24Vac power requirement and 3/4" NPT threading allow for rapid installation into existing pipe headers.
Common Questions
Can the Siemens 242-00212 be mounted in any orientation?
Standard practice for these Siemens 242 series valves is to mount the actuator above the valve body to prevent moisture from entering the motor housing, though they can be mounted horizontally if required by space constraints.
What is the maximum operating pressure for this brass zone valve?
This 3/4 inch NPT zone valve is typically rated for a maximum static pressure of 300 psi, though it is optimized for standard hydronic system operating pressures.
Does this unit function as a diverting valve?
No, this is a 2-way normally closed configuration designed strictly for on/off flow control through a single circuit.
